Definition

Autumn is the season between summer and winter when the weather becomes cooler and the leaves on the trees change color and fall off.

Usage note

While 'fall' is a common synonym, 'autumn' is generally considered more formal and is preferred in literary or academic contexts. 'Autumn' is the standard term in British English.
